Honey Sriracha Salmon Bowls

Delicious and easy to prepare, Honey Sriracha Salmon Bowls are perfect for a quick weeknight meal.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 salmon fillets
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 2 tablespoons Sriracha sauce
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 2 cups cooked rice
  • 1 cup steamed vegetables (like broccoli or snap peas)
  • 2 green onions,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a small bowl, whisk together honey, Sriracha, and soy sauce to create the glaze.
  3. Place the salmon fillets on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and brush with the glaze.
  4.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the salmon is cooked through.
  5. In bowls, layer cooked rice, steamed vegetables, and top with the glazed salmon.
  6. Garnish with chopped green onions and sesame seeds before serving.

Notes

  • This dish can be served with any variety of vegetables.
  • Adjust Sriracha according to your spice preference.
